
BAS40SL
Schottky Barrier Diodes
Features
• Low Forward Voltage Drop
• Fast switching
• Very Small and Thin SMD package
• Profile height, 0.43mm max
• Footprint, 1.0 x 0.6mm

* These ratings are limiting values above which the serviceability of the diode may be impaired.
The factory should be consulted on applications involving pulsed or low duty cycle operations.
Maximum Repetitive Reverse Voltage 40 V
Average Rectified Forward Current 100 mA
Forward Surge Current
600 mA
(8.3mS Single Half Sine-Wave)
Power Dissipation 227 mW
Operating Junction & Storage Temperature Range -55 to +150 °C
